Bridgestone's Hurley Wins Hard-Fought Victory: From Persian Gulf to PGA TOUR
Former Navy Lieutenant Finishes 25th on 2011 Nationwide Tour Money List, Earns PGA TOUR Card
COVINGTON, GA — In Charleston, South Carolina, this weekend, Billy Hurley
III fulfilled a lifelong dream, using his T18 finish at the Nationwide Tour
Championship to secure the 25th spot on the 2011 Nationwide money list and a monumental
reward: his 2012 PGA TOUR card. As he had done all year, Hurley relied on
a deft putting touch and accurate tee shots to earn $13,040 to hold off the #26
Money List finisher by a mere $6,000.
Hurley's path to the biggest stage in golf was one seldom traveled these days. After
a highly decorated collegiate golf career (that included a spot on the 2004 U.S.
Walker Cup Team) and graduation from the U.S. Naval Academy in 2004, Hurley served
a mandatory 5-years in the United States Navy. Hurley's service included a stint
as Lieutenant aboard the destroyer USS Chung-Hoon in the Persian Gulf. Hurley's
duty while aboard the Chung-Hoon was safeguarding two of the world's largest oil
platforms during the Iraq War.
